Join us at TEDxKTH – our digital futures!

Mark your calendars for 3 September 2024, from 14:00 to 18:00 (doors open at 13:15) at Open Box, Kista, Stockholm!

Embark on a journey into the heart of digital transformation with industry experts, innovators, and thought leaders. From groundbreaking AI innovations to cutting-edge healthcare and sustainability solutions, TEDxKTH 2024 will explore how digital technologies are reshaping our world. Speaker highlights:

  • Erik Rosales: Dive into AI and identity with his interactive performance lecture, AI.DENTITY.
  • Madeline Balaam: Discover the future of care robots and how design shapes our experiences.
  • Jörg Conradt: Learn about energy-efficient neuromorphic computing inspired by the human brain.
  • Lanie Gutierrez-Farewik: Explore the future of mobility through biomechanics and AI.
  • Mats J. Mudigonda Lundbäck: Uncover the future of telecom and digital connectivity.
  • Angela Fontan: Delve into the role of technology in collective decision-making and explore the dynamics of opinion formation over social networks.
  • Frank Jiang: Rethink the internet for vehicle automation.
  • Ilaria Testa: Experience smart microscopy that’s revolutionizing life sciences.
